If you want to makeyour lips plumper:
|  | Underline the natural contour of your lips applying the line on the external border of contour with the help of the pencil which corresponds to the color of your lipstick.
|  | Thoroughly and carefully fill in the space between the lines you’ve drawn using your favorite lipstick.
|  | With the help of a brush apply some pearl glitter. It will reflect the light and create the effect of plump lips. To add extra volume you need to apply more glitter on the lower lip than on the upper one.
|  | Draw the line a bit above the applied contour of upper lip using a soft light pencil. The pencil should be of a neutral color, giving no shade and slightly lightening the area above upper lip.
|  | To make the borders invisible you need to use a sponge or a cosmetic stick to shade the drawn line. Make-up is ready.
| | If you want your lips seem narrower: |  | Apply the line along the external border of lips by means of the contour pencil. Cover your lips with powder if you want the lipstick stay longer.
|  | Apply the lipstick carefully by means of a brush. Stay in the borders of your natural contour. The lipstick has to be mat. Lipsticks adding glance and glitter reflect the light and make your lips plumper. | |
